All-Star Weekend: Top Players Face Off in the Midseason Classic

All-Star Weekend is one of the most celebrated events in professional sports, and the NBA’s version is no exception. This annual showcase brings together the league’s elite players for a weekend filled with festivities, culminating in the All-Star Game itself. The event not only highlights individual talent but also fosters camaraderie among players who often compete fiercely during the regular season.

This year’s All-Star Weekend promises to be particularly exciting, as it will feature a new format for the All-Star Game designed to enhance competitiveness and entertainment value. In addition to the main event, All-Star Weekend includes various competitions such as the Slam Dunk Contest and Three-Point Contest, where players display their skills in front of a captivated audience. The Slam Dunk Contest has produced some of the most iconic moments in NBA history, with players like Vince Carter and Zach LaVine etching their names into folklore through gravity-defying dunks.

Meanwhile, the Three-Point Contest has evolved into a showcase of sharpshooting prowess, with players like Stephen Curry and Klay Thompson consistently pushing the boundaries of what is possible from beyond the arc. Rivalry games are often regarded as the lifeblood of any sports league, and the NBA is no exception. These matchups carry historical significance and evoke passionate responses from players and fans alike. One of the most intense rivalries in recent years has been between the Los Angeles Lakers and the Boston Celtics.

Their storied history dates back to the 1960s and has seen numerous Finals matchups that have defined eras of basketball. Each time these two teams meet on the court, it’s not just another game; it’s an event steeped in tradition and pride. Another notable rivalry is between the Chicago Bulls and the New York Knicks.

While both teams have experienced ups and downs over the years, their encounters are always charged with emotion. The Bulls’ legacy from the Michael Jordan era still looms large, while the Knicks’ passionate fanbase adds an extra layer of intensity to their meetings. These games often feature hard-fought battles that showcase not only skill but also grit and determination.

Trade Deadline: Potential Impact on Playoff Race

The NBA trade deadline is a pivotal moment in the season that can dramatically alter team trajectories as they vie for playoff positioning. Teams often assess their rosters and make strategic moves to either bolster their chances for a deep playoff run or rebuild for future seasons. This year’s trade deadline is particularly intriguing due to several teams being on the cusp of contention or facing potential rebuilds.

For instance, teams like the Dallas Mavericks may look to acquire additional talent to support their star player Luka Dončić as they aim for a playoff berth. Conversely, franchises such as the Portland Trail Blazers might consider trading away key players if they determine that they are not in contention for a championship this season. The decisions made during this period can have far-reaching implications not only for individual teams but also for the overall landscape of the league.

A blockbuster trade could shift power dynamics within conferences, making certain teams instant contenders while others may find themselves struggling to keep pace. FAQs

What is the NBA schedule?

The NBA schedule is a calendar of games for the National Basketball Association teams, outlining the dates, times, and opponents for each game in the regular season.

When is the NBA schedule released?

The NBA schedule is typically released in August, before the start of the regular season.

How many games are in the NBA schedule?

In a typical NBA season, each team plays 82 games in the regular season.

How are NBA games scheduled?

NBA games are scheduled by the league office, taking into account factors such as travel, rest days, and television broadcast schedules.

Can the NBA schedule change?

Yes, the NBA schedule can change due to unforeseen circumstances such as severe weather, arena availability, or other logistical issues.
